Here's the thing, Love.... if you don't put you first, who else will?

Self-love is one of the most difficult things to internalize, in my opinion.

"Self-love is so important!"
"You need to love yourself before you can love anyone else!"
"You're the only one there for you at the end of the day!"

While all of those statements are very much true, and we preach it 24/7, how many of us actually implement it?

Self-love is something that you need to put action to in your own life. No significant other, family member or friend can do this for you. Self-love is all about learning to love yourself. The teacher is you. You need to find ways each and every day to learn to adore the good, and bad, parts of you. It all starts with you.

This isn't an easy process, either. You can just magically wake up one day and be like, "I love myself!" Don't get me wrong, you deff can have some of those days where you wake up feeling like a boss, but self-love is something that festers in your bones. It takes a while to condition your brain to love yourself, especially on your worst days.

Every day, take one step towards self-love. Take 15 minutes to walk and clear your mind. Read your favorite book. Take a long shower. Buy yourself that sweet treat you've been craving all day. One thing a day, even for 5 minutes, will change how you feel about yourself in the long run.

Self-love is something I struggle with every day. Some days I'll wake up feeling strong and determined, while others I just feel like going back to bed. But the one thing that keeps me going is that 5 minutes of "me time." A little self-love goes a long way.
